Hi

I’m having problems with my 2002 focus. The central locking has stopped working. I can’t unlock the back doors from the inside or outside. The button for the boot on the dash doesn’t work. The indicators, intermittent wipers, rear wiper, heated front and back windscreen don’t work as well.

So far we’ve tried changing the battery in the key fob, resetting the key in the ignition, checked all fuses and relays and disconnected the Siemens box under the steering wheel. Is there anything else we could try?

It's possible that you have more than one fault. Check for broken wires where they pass from the main body to the tailgate,also check all earth connections for good clean contact to the chassis etc.

I've since got a haynes manual which suggests it might be something to do with GEM box which is the siemens box. When we disconnected it we only disconnected 2 plugs as that was all my uncle could see. I’ve had another look at I have 5. Is it worth disconnecting these to reset the box?
 
I think you have to disconnect everything from the locking module and leave it half hour or so before plugging it all back in

I did get the problem solved. It was the GEM box that needed replacing.

Unfortunately it's something that only ford can replace as they have to take the setting off the old box to put on the new one. Cost me £300 to get it repaired.
 
thanks very much, got it sorted, got 2nd hand gem box from my local scrapyard £20 just had to reset the key which is a very simple procedure found by google search.
